The Music Management Contract for construction projects in California is designed to formalize the relationship between an artist and their manager, outlining the roles and responsibilities of each party. This contract highlights the manager's obligation to advise, guide, and advocate for the artist's career while also allowing the manager to represent the artist in negotiations. Key features include the manager's authority to make decisions on behalf of the artist and the artist's commitment to working exclusively with the manager for their professional needs. The contract specifies the method of compensation, which involves a predetermined percentage of the artist's gross monthly earnings. It also covers aspects like the potential for termination, confidentiality obligations, and the necessity for written modifications to be binding. As a general rule, managers take a percentage of all income generated by the artist in exchange for their management services. Commission rates typically range from 15-25% of the artist's gross income from: Recording royalties: Sales, streaming and licensing of recorded music.

How long is a normal artist manager contract? The standard length of the management contract is three years but it can vary from 2 to 5 years on a case by case basis. Most contracts also include a "Sunset" clause.

An Artist Management Agreement is used by a personal manager to contract with a recording and performing musical artist to set the terms for managing the artist's career. The manager receives a percentage of all the income generated by the artist for the management services provided.

Managers' commissions are typically between 15 to 20% of an artist's gross income. Whether it's 15% or 20% really depends on the level of the band and the bargaining power of each party. I've seen some net deals, but they are extremely rare. That being said, I always push for a net commission on merchandise.
